Output d055cc07298740ec0e7c5a4e1d669fcd17cbb868f320b51cb7b902ca93f3e85e:128

value
139421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d0ac4fa578cec6b0e68709ef7cc87cd3ee4fa04 OP_EQUAL
address
34LaRP3tmEDCswMMbpmjnnXC5CVh9rJyP6
transaction
d055cc07298740ec0e7c5a4e1d669fcd17cbb868f320b51cb7b902ca93f3e85e
confirmations
170442
spent
true